• Kim Sae Ron Sent a Desperate SOS to Kim Soo Hyun Over 700 Million KRW Debt But He Reportedly Completely Ignored Her - Here's What Happened

    Gold Medalist reportedly pressured Kim Sae Ron to repay 700 million KRW (approx. $530,000), leaving her in a desperate situation.

    The agency even sent her a legal notice, demanding full repayment and threatening legal action.

    At the time, Kim Sae Ron was struggling financially. Her contract with Gold Medalist had already ended, and she likely believed that the debt had been settled. But when she received the demand for full repayment, she had no choice but to turn to Kim Soo Hyun for help.

    According to Dispatch, Kim Sae Ron sent a message to Kim Soo Hyun on March 24, 2024:

    "Oppa, it's Sae Ron. I received a certified document. They’re saying they’ll sue me. If they demand 700 million KRW right away, I really can’t do it. Does it really have to go to a lawsuit? Please help me. Give me some time."

    However, Kim Soo Hyun reportedly did not respond.

    After being ignored, Kim Sae Ron allegedly took a bold step—she released a photo of them together. Many believe this was a subtle message urging Kim Soo Hyun to acknowledge their past relationship and step in to help.

    Despite this, he still didn’t respond.

    While Kim Sae Ron’s financial situation hadn’t changed, something on Kim Soo Hyun’s side had.

    Gold Medalist later told Dispatch:

    "Considering Kim Sae Ron’s situation, we decided not to take the money."

    But why the sudden change? Some speculate that Kim Soo Hyun might have played a role behind the scenes, though he never publicly acknowledged it.

    A neighbor who lived in the same apartment building as Kim Sae Ron shared a heartbreaking story.

    "She sat on the stairs crying for a long time. I felt bad for her, so I comforted her. She seemed to be going through something really difficult."

    The neighbor also noticed scars on her wrists, hinting at the emotional pain she was going through.

    After all the speculation, Gold Medalist denied everything.

    "All rumors are false."

    But Dispatch suggests otherwise, saying that many insiders confirmed Kim Sae Ron and Kim Soo Hyun’s past relationship.

    One source claimed:

    "Because of Kim Sae Ron’s young age at the time, there was no way he could publicly acknowledge their relationship."

    While it’s impossible to say what ultimately led to Kim Sae Ron’s passing, her struggles with debt, legal issues, public scrutiny, and emotional distress definitely played a role.

  • Red Velvet’s Yeri Shares Emotional Message for Late Friend Kim Sae Ron: “I Didn’t Leave You”

    Red Velvet’s Yeri has touched fans with a heartfelt tribute to her late friend Kim Sae Ron.

    On March 12, Yeri posted a photo on her social media, showing herself with a woman believed to be Kim Sae Ron. The two were seen affectionately linking arms, reminding fans of their close friendship.

    But what really caught attention was the message Yeri shared alongside the photo. She included lyrics from Jennie’s song "Slow Motion (feat. Zico)", which has gained meaning after Jennie revealed she wrote it "for one special friend."

    Yeri specifically highlighted this line:
    "I didn't leave ya, I still see ya."

    Yeri and Kim Sae Ron were known to be best friends in the entertainment industry. Their bond was so strong that when Yeri took her first-ever vacation, she chose to travel to Bali with Kim Sae Ron.

    Meanwhile, Kim Sae Ron’s family recently made shocking claims through the YouTube channel Garo Sero Institute. They alleged that she had been in a six-year relationship with Kim Soo Hyun since she was 15 years old and that her former agency, Gold Medalist, initially covered the ₩700 million KRW (~$530,000 USD) for her DUI accident, only to later demand repayment after her contract ended.

    It was also claimed that Kim Sae Ron had posted an old photo with Kim Soo Hyun in an attempt to get in contact with him or his agency, as they had allegedly cut her off.

    However, Gold Medalist firmly denied all allegations, stating, “The claims made by Garo Sero Institute regarding actor Kim Soo Hyun are completely false.”
